Summary:The reliability design is related to the performance analysis of engineering systems. The reliability - redundancy optimization problems involve selection of components with multiple choices and redundancy levels that produce maximum benefits, can be subject to the cost, weight, volume and reliability constraints. Classical mathematical methods fail in handling non-convexities and non-smoothness in optimization problems. This drawback has been removed through meta-heuristics due to their ability of finding an almost global optimal solution in reliability-redundancy optimization problems. Particle swarm optimization (PSO) is one of such meta-heuristic algorithm. An efficient penalty based PSO algorithm has been proposed in this paper for reliability-redundancy optimization problems. This paper aims to present an application of the PSO algorithm for searching the optimal solution of reliability-redundancy allocation problems with nonlinear resource constraints of a Pharmaceutical Plant.
